Output 377898c486b50a8103ddbce161c9b854eda10de023159ecc58b0ae360b90faf8:27

value
502538
script pubkey
OP_0 OP_PUSHBYTES_20 c70523995a417c762619b942d2ccd589fe640a6b
address
bc1qcuzj8x26g978vfseh9pd9nx438lxgznthcl2f0
transaction
377898c486b50a8103ddbce161c9b854eda10de023159ecc58b0ae360b90faf8
spent
true